Facial oils are having a big moment since last year and although I was quite sceptic for a long time I have found five oils working so much in my favor I consider them totally worth the hype!

DHC Deep Cleansing Oil
My latest addiction in terms of makeup remover. This miracle working DHC Deep Cleansing Oil removes every little trace of dirt, makeup and cosmetics and leaves your skin super soft and visibly nourished thanks to antioxidant-rich olive oil. The ultimate cleanser by far!

Clarins Lotus Fibre Treatment Oil
As I have mentioned before I have been dealing with oily skin and breakouts for quite some time now. And so I understand everyone's anxiety when it comes to treating oily skin with oils but I can 100% assure you this Lotus Fibre Treatment Oil works as a natural astringent and will immediately reduce all impurities. Hazelnut oil will additionally sooth and moisture your skin all day.

Aveda Tulasara Oleation Oil
In my ever lasting search for that naturally glowing skin I might have found my ultimate holy grail with Aveda's Tulasara Oleation Oil. Together with the dry brush it results in ultimate microcirculation for a restored radiance. Star ingredients are sesame, jojoba, sweet almond and sunflower oil.

Caudalie Vine Activ Overnight Detox Oil
Never underestimate the importance of overnight skincare! Recently I started renewing and protecting my 30+ skin with the revitalizing Vine Activ Overnight Detox Oil by Caudalie and am waking up with smoothed skin and a healthier looking complexion.

Decléor Aromessence Ylang Cananga Facial Oil Serum
When in desperate need of getting rid of unwanted skin shine ad clearing imperfections I am grabbing for this Decléor Aromessence Ylang Cananga Facial Oil Serum. It not only tightens my pores but also purifies and matifies my skin for a much clearer and toned complexion.
